Situated on a very gentle S-facing slope in pasture with possible enclosure site (TN021-078002-) c. 50m to the SSW and ringfort (TN021-077----) c. 240m to the NW. A possible site indicated as a cropmark on an aerial photograph taken in 1973 (GSIAP, R 22/1). Not visible at ground level. A house, built c. 1975, occupies the approximate location of the cropmark and reclamation work was carried out in field at the same time.
The above description is derived from 'The Archaeological Inventory of County Tipperary. Vol. 1 - North Tipperary' compiled by Jean Farrelly and Caimin O'Brien (Dublin: Stationery Office, 2002). In certain instances the entries have been revised and updated in the light of recent research.
